Declan Rice Defends Noni Madueke After His Signing for Arsenal
Arsenal midfielder Declan Rice has come to the defense of his new teammate, Noni Madueke, against the negative reaction from some fans following his arrival at the club. Rice expressed his discontent with the criticism received by Madueke through social media and assured that the winger will “surprise” everyone with his quality this season. Madueke, 23, joined the Gunners earlier this month from Chelsea, in a deal that could reach £52 million. The player’s arrival generated controversy among some fans, who expressed their disapproval and even vandalized murals outside the Emirates Stadium. The hashtag #NoToMadueke also gained prominence on social media, with fans expressing concerns about his performance during his two seasons at Chelsea. However, Rice, who forged a friendship with Madueke during their time together in the England national team, offered a positive opinion about the player.Rice highlighted Madueke’s determination to prove his worth and his desire to succeed at Arsenal. In addition, the midfielder mentioned a letter he wrote as part of Madueke’s presentation, where he welcomed him to the Arsenal family.“I didn’t like it, being honest,” Rice said about the reaction to Madueke, who is not on Arsenal’s pre-season tour in Asia after his participation in Chelsea’s successful Club World Cup campaign. “But I know how motivated he is. I’ve spoken to him and you’re going to see what he’s all about this season.
